
Pregalin MNT 75mg/10mg/1500mcg Tablet
Marketer
Torrent Pharmaceuticals Ltd
Salt Composition
Pregabalin (75mg) + Nortriptyline (10mg) + Methylcobalamin (1500mcg)
Overview Pregalin MNT 75mg/10mg/1500mcg Tablet
Neuropathic pain relief is provided by the combined-action Pregalin MNT 75mg/10mg/1500mcg tablet. Its mechanism involves modulating nerve cell calcium channel activity to reduce pain signals. Simultaneously, it boosts brain neurotransmitters, improving mood regulation and nerve fiber protection. This medication can be administered with or without food, but consistent daily timing is recommended for optimal blood levels. Always follow your physician's prescribed dosage and duration. Missed doses should be taken upon recollection. Complete the entire course of treatment, even with symptom improvement. Abrupt cessation should be avoided due to potential symptom exacerbation. Common side effects include constipation, weight increase, and dry mouth. Dizziness and drowsiness may occur; avoid activities requiring alertness until the drug's effects are understood. Weight gain may be a consequence; counter this with a balanced diet and regular physical activity. Report any unusual mood or behavioral shifts, new or worsening depression, or suicidal ideation to your doctor immediately. Prior to commencing treatment, disclose any kidney or liver conditions, and provide a comprehensive list of all other medications being consumed, as interactions can affect efficacy or mechanism. Inform your doctor of pregnancy, pregnancy plans, or breastfeeding.

Common Side effects of Pregalin MNT 75mg/10mg/1500mcg Tablet:
- Orthostatic hypotension (sudden lowering of blood pressure on standing)
- Increased heart rate
- Difficulty in urination
- Decreased appetite
- Nausea
- Vomiting
- Constipation
- Weight gain
- Dizziness
- Sleepiness
- Tiredness
- Blurred vision
- Dryness in mouth
- Uncoordinated body movements
- Diarrhea
- Headache

How Pregalin MNT 75mg/10mg/1500mcg Tablet works:
Pregalin MNT 75mg/10mg/1500mcg tablets contain pregabalin, nortriptyline, and methylcobalamin, working synergistically to alleviate neuropathic pain. Pregabalin, an alpha-2-delta calcium channel ligand, reduces pain transmission by modulating nerve cell activity. Nortriptyline, a tricyclic antidepressant, elevates serotonin and noradrenaline levels, thus inhibiting pain signal propagation in the brain. Methylcobalamin, a B vitamin, supports myelin sheath production and repair, protecting and regenerating nerve fibers. This combined action provides effective relief from nerve-related pain.
S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holUNSAFE
Concurrent use of Pregalin MNT 75mg/10mg/1500mcg tablets and alcohol can lead to increased sleepiness.
Preg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
The use of Pregalin MNT 75mg/10mg/1500mcg tablets during pregnancy may pose risks. While human data is scarce, animal research indicates potential harm to a fetus. A physician will assess the potential benefits against any risks prior to prescribing this medication. Seek medical advice.
Breast feeding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Lactation and Pregalin MNT 75mg/10mg/1500mcg tablets are likely incompatible. Available data from humans indicate potential transfer of the medication into breast milk, posing a risk to the infant.
DrivingUNSAFE
Driving ability may be impaired by Pregalin MNT 75mg/10mg/1500mcg Tablets, due to potential side effects that can reduce alertness.
KidneyCAUTION
Patients with kidney disease should use Pregalin MNT 75mg/10mg/1500mcg tablets cautiously. Dosage modification of Pregalin MNT 75mg/10mg/1500mcg tablets may be necessary. Physician consultation is advised.
LiverSAFE IF PRESCRIBED
The use of Pregalin MNT 75mg/10mg/1500mcg tablets in individuals with liver conditions is likely safe. Existing evidence indicates dose modification may be unnecessary, but a physician's consultation is recommended.
What if you forget to take Pregalin MNT 75mg/10mg/1500mcg Tablet :
Should you forget to take a Pregalin MNT 75mg/10mg/1500mcg Tablet, administer it immediately upon remembering. Nevertheless, if your next scheduled d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.
